Vietnamese consume 2.9 billion instant noodle packs in 2016

Nguyen Le May 25, 2017 | 06:54 AM GMT+7

The data was updated by the World Instant Noodles Association (WINA) on May 11.

Vina Acecook, Masan Consumer and Asia Foods are the three largest producers of instant noodles. Photo: Internet

Compared with 2015, Vietnam's market has rebounded after falling from the peak of 5.2 billion noodle packages in 2013.


Vietnam is still the fourth largest market for noodles in the world after China, Indonesia and Japan. Source: WINA


Vietnam's instant noodles consumption has declined over the last few years as annual average consumption continues to be high. 

By 2015, it is estimated that each Vietnamese consumes 52 packs of noodle, just lower than that of South Korea (73 packs).

Many other countries also experience the lower demand of instant noodle, except India with a rise of 30% last year.

In Vietnam, Vina Acecook, Masan Consumer and Asia Foods are the three largest producers, accounting for 70% of the instant noodles market.
